ANSTEY (WEST), a parish in the hundred of SOUTH-MOLTON, county of DEVON, 3½ miles (W.) from Dulverton, containing 220 inhabitants. The living is a discharged vicarage, in the archdeaconry of Barnstap1.e, and diocese of Exeter, rated in the king's books at £10. 16. 8., and in the patronage of the Dean and Chapter of Exeter. The church is dedicated to St. Petrock. Here is an unendowed almshouse for the reception of the aged and-infirm poor.
